The Renaissance Masters: Architects of a New Era

Alright, let's kick things off with the Renaissance, a period that saw an explosion of creativity and innovation, and it all began with some of the most influential Italian people. Names like Leonardo da Vinci, Michelangelo, and Raphael immediately spring to mind. These guys weren't just artists; they were Renaissance men – multi-talented individuals who excelled in various fields.

Leonardo da Vinci, the ultimate Renaissance man, was a genius in every sense of the word. He was a painter, sculptor, architect, musician, scientist, inventor, and more! His masterpiece, the Mona Lisa, is probably the most famous painting in the world, and his scientific studies and inventions, such as the flying machine, were centuries ahead of their time. Da Vinci's contributions to art, science, and engineering have had a profound impact on the world. He was a true visionary who pushed the boundaries of knowledge and creativity. His inventions and scientific studies were groundbreaking, and his artistic talent was unparalleled. He continues to inspire artists, scientists, and innovators to this day. His legacy is a testament to the power of human intellect and the pursuit of knowledge. Michelangelo, another giant of the Renaissance, was a sculptor, painter, architect, and poet. His sculptures, such as David and the Pietà, are marvels of human artistry. His work on the Sistine Chapel ceiling is one of the most famous and influential artworks in history. His artistic contributions are recognized and celebrated worldwide. Michelangelo's works continue to inspire and move people, and his impact on art history is undeniable. His artistry is celebrated for its technical mastery, emotional depth, and innovative approach to sculpture and painting. He was a master of his craft and his legacy continues to inspire artists and art enthusiasts. Raphael, the third member of this iconic trio, was a painter and architect. His works, such as The School of Athens, are celebrated for their harmony, beauty, and grace. He painted numerous portraits, and his influence on art is still felt today. He had a unique talent for capturing the beauty of the human form and expressing complex ideas through his artwork. Raphael's paintings are admired for their composition, color palette, and the emotions they convey. He left a lasting impact on art history, inspiring generations of artists to come.

Scientific Pioneers: Revolutionizing Knowledge

Let's switch gears and talk about some brilliant minds who changed the world through science. One of the most famous Italian people is Galileo Galilei. This guy was a groundbreaking astronomer, physicist, and engineer. He made significant contributions to our understanding of the universe. Galileo's use of the telescope revolutionized astronomy, and his observations of the moons of Jupiter and the phases of Venus provided crucial evidence supporting the heliocentric model of the solar system. He was a key figure in the scientific revolution, challenging established beliefs and paving the way for modern science. His courage and intellectual curiosity are truly remarkable. Galileo's work was groundbreaking, leading to significant discoveries that changed our understanding of the world and the universe. He was a pioneer who dared to challenge the status quo, and his influence continues to resonate in the field of science. Galileo’s contributions to science are still studied and celebrated today. He was a brilliant mind who changed the course of history.

Another famous Italian in science is Alessandro Volta. He was a physicist and chemist who invented the electric battery. His invention of the voltaic pile, the first electrochemical battery, was a groundbreaking achievement. Volta's work laid the foundation for the study of electricity and its applications. His work was revolutionary, and it paved the way for the development of modern electrical technology. Volta's legacy continues to inspire scientists and engineers. His work has had a lasting impact on our lives.

Cultural Icons: Shaping the Arts and Entertainment

Now, let's step into the dazzling world of arts and entertainment and talk about some famous Italians. Italy's cultural influence is vast. Dante Alighieri, the author of the Divine Comedy, is considered the father of the Italian language. His epic poem is a cornerstone of Western literature. Dante's work shaped the Italian language and is still studied and admired today. His writing is a testament to the power of language and storytelling. His profound insights into human nature and his exploration of morality have resonated with readers for centuries. Dante's influence extends far beyond the boundaries of Italy.

Moving on to music, Enrico Caruso was a legendary tenor. He was one of the most celebrated opera singers of all time. His powerful voice and captivating performances made him a global superstar. Caruso's recordings helped popularize opera around the world. His voice was iconic, and his artistry set a new standard for opera performance. He continues to be an inspiration for singers today. Enrico Caruso's contributions to music have left an indelible mark on the world.
